  2. I had the same problem! LOL I realized after many attempts, that I was only able to hear it when I placed the chest piece beneath the cuff right on top of the brachial artery haha (I got this idea because my mom purchased a stethascope/sphygmomanometer and they were fused together as such) . But we're not supposed to do that XD - THOUGH I made very accurate readings! (Or so I was told.. and I was so sad when I found out I couldn't do it that way haha) I don't know, it took me a lot of practice before I could hear the systolic with the chest piece outside the cuff. LOTS of practice. What also helped was looking at the dial! Because sometimes you can tell about when the sounds are supposed to occur... so I guess by knowing when to expect sounds helped me distinguish them. haha.   3. yay!!! gratz!!! first of all, BOOKS. when i started, i bought every single textbook required, when really, we didn't even touch some them. i suggest you speak with a previous nursing student from your school regarding the book issue. because they're expensive, and you would not want to buy it if you didn't have to. also, some of the books required i found at the school library haha. so you may want to check there before purchasing. as for the stethoscope, at my school, if there were more than 15 students making an order, we got discounted. so i suggest you consult with your nursing peers if they're making an order before buying. OH and make lots of friends =) they help ease the experience, especially during rough semesters
